Soccer is by far one of the most popular sports globally, with an estimated fanbase of over 3.5 billion. Because of such a massive fanbase engaging with sports leagues like the Premier League, UEFA, and FIFA, the sport is able to generate enough revenue to support its players.
In 2024, the global soccer market generated $3.5 billion and is expected to generate up to $4.7 billion by 2033. As such, football players are one of the highest-paid athletes, with an average salary of $32,476 per year. According to research from Statista on the highest-paid athletes in soccer, Cristiano Ronaldo emerged as the highest-earning soccer player globally in 2024, earning around 260 million U.S. dollars annually. Coming next is Lionel Messi, earning around $135 million per year.

Basketball is one of the highest paid sports in the industry, with tournaments like the NBA, FIBA, CBA, and the Asia League, amongst others, commanding an immense global audience. Basketball is a multi-billion dollar sport, with many basketball players making hundreds of millions annually.
Top NBA players like LeBron James earn up to $128.2 million per year, and Stephen Curry of the Golden State Warriors earns a base salary of $55.76 million per year from contracts and endorsements from the likes of Nike, Coca-Cola, Upper Deck, and so on. On average, NBA salaries are about $10.82 million per year.
American Football is no doubt one of the biggest sports in North America. Led by the National Football League (NFL), the most famous North American sports football league in the world. In 2023, the league generated over $18.7 billion in revenue, of which a significant portion comes from broadcasting rights.
American football players are well paid, with the highest-paid American footballer, Lamar Jackson, earning around $100.5 million annually, and popular Dallas Cowboys star Dak Prescott earning an average annual salary of $60 million. The average salary of American footballers is around $2.8 million per year.
Baseball is another extremely popular sport spearheaded by Major League Baseball. To put it in a clearer perspective, the MLB alone amasses over 171.1 million fans. Furthermore, according to the U.S. Census Bureau, about 13 million Americans play baseball.
It is a lucrative sport generating billions on a yearly basis, as it recorded over $11 billion in revenue in 2023. The average salary of an MLB player is approximately $52,000 per year. However, there are players like Shohei Ohtani, the highest-paid baseball player, who receives an annual salary of roughly $85.3 million.

An average MMA fighter’s annual salary is approximately $150,249. But within the same industry, some pro fighters like Conor McGregor and Khabib Nurmagomedov get paid in the hundreds of millions. In 2021, Conor McGregor was the highest-paid professional athlete globally, earning approximately $180 million.
Car racing, particularly Formula 1, is another well-paid sport filled with the thrill of high speed, high earning, and high stakes. Car racing is popular for events like Moto GP and NASCAR, as they have a massive fanbase making it a profitable sport.
Most Formula 1 and NASCAR drivers get paid well, but the average salaries range from $43,879 to $92,610 per year. However, top Formula 1 racers like Lewis Hamilton earn $55 million annually, and NASCAR driver Kyle Busch earns over $16.9 million annually.
This list won’t be complete without mentioning the NHL. Ice hockey might not have a massive fanbase like other sports in most countries, but it is well-represented in the few countries that appreciate it.
As one of the most lucrative sports on our list, Ice Hockey generated over $6.3 billion in 2023-2024. It is such a prominent sport that hockey players often take top positions in the Forbes highest-paid athletes for the year.
While the national average annual salary of an ice hockey player is around $77,300. But top hockey players like Connor McDavid are among the highest-paid players, earning over $12 million annually.
